Understanding THCA: The Precursor to THC

THCA, or tetrahydrocannabinolic acid, is a non-psychoactive cannabinoid found in raw cannabis. It is the precursor to THC, the compound known for its psychoactive effects. When heated through smoking or vaporizing, THCA is transformed into THC, causing the psychoactive effects usually associated with cannabis consumption. This transformation process is known as decarboxylation.

Why THCA Products Are Gaining Popularity

The growing interest in THCA can be attributed to several factors. Firstly, THCA is said to offer therapeutic benefits without the psychoactive effects associated with THC. This makes it appealing to those seeking relief from inflammation, nausea, and other conditions without the ‘high.’ Additionally, as the cannabis industry becomes more sophisticated, consumers are increasingly exploring nuanced products like THCA vapes, which provide targeted effects and experiences.

THCA vs. HHC: Navigating the Choices

Alongside THCA, other cannabinoids like HHC (hexahydrocannabinol) are also making waves. While THCA is derived from cannabis, HHC is a semi-synthetic product. The effects and preferences for such products vary greatly among users, highlighting the importance of understanding the distinctions and potential benefits of each.
